Description
Delightful and colorful Rainbow Cheesecake Bars with a creamy cheesecake filling on a crunchy Oreo base, topped with vibrant whipped cream.
Ingredients
Scale
- 2 packets (260g) Golden Oreos
- 1/2 cup (125g) unsalted butter, melted
- 1/4 cup (50g) rainbow sprinkles
- 1 block (250g) cream cheese, softened
- 1 cup (200g) white chocolate, melted
- 1 cup (250ml) heavy cream
- 1/2 cup (125g) mascarpone cheese
- 1 tsp vanilla extract
- 1/2 cup (50g) rainbow sprinkles (for topping)
- 1 1/4 cups (310ml) heavy cream (for whipped topping)
- 1/2 cup (125g) mascarpone cheese (for whipped topping)
- 1 tsp vanilla extract (for whipped topping)
- Food gel (yellow, orange, pink, blue, green) – 2 drops of each color
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
- Place the Golden Oreos in a food processor and blend into fine crumbs.
- Combine the Oreo crumbs with the melted butter and 1/4 cup of rainbow sprinkles in a bowl, mixing well.
- Press the mixture evenly into the base of a 9×9-inch pan lined with parchment paper. Set aside.
- In a large mixing bowl, beat the softened cream cheese until smooth.
- Add the melted white chocolate, heavy cream, mascarpone cheese, and vanilla extract. Beat until smooth and fluffy.
- Fold in the 1/2 cup of rainbow sprinkles, then pour the cheesecake mixture over the Oreo base and smooth it out evenly.
- Place the pan in the fridge and allow it to set for at least 2 hours, or until firm.
- In a mixing bowl, beat the heavy cream, mascarpone cheese, and vanilla extract until soft peaks form.
- Divide the whipped cream into five separate bowls. Add 2 drops of each food gel color (yellow, orange, pink, blue, green) to each bowl, and stir until evenly colored.
- Transfer each colored whipped cream into piping bags fitted with star tips.
- Once the cheesecake layer is fully set, pipe the rainbow whipped cream on top in colorful patterns.
- Slice the cheesecake into 9 bars and serve.
Notes
Chill the bars for the best texture and serve with extra rainbow sprinkles or a drizzle of chocolate sauce.
